基于GREEN BIM理念的城市居住区规划优化设计研究——以西安地区为例  

Research on Optimal Design of Urban Residential District Planning Based on the Concept of GREEN BIM——A Case of Xi’an

摘  要:在我国全民关注居住环境的舒适和品质,建设更加安全健康的城市和人居环境的背景下,本文通过前期资料收集及实地调研,对西安地区住区进行实地调研与分析,总结分析出既有住区存在的问题并提出相应的优化思路。以《绿色建筑评价标准》(GB/T 50378—2019)提出的建筑绿色性能为目标,通过BIM技术与绿色建筑设计相互融合的方法,进行绿色性能模拟。梳理出基于适宜性生态设计的绿色住区规划设计策略,以西安市西咸新区某住区为例进行绿色住区设计实践,确定适宜性绿色住区设计策略,为西安地区乃至全国的绿色住宅设计理论进行补充和完善,为今后同类项目提供理论参考。Under the background that Chinese people pay attention to the comfort and quality of the living environment and build a safer and healthier city and living environment,this paper conducts field investigation and analysis on the residential areas in Xi’an through preliminary data collection and field investigation,summarizes and analyzes the problems existing in the existing residential areas and puts forward the corresponding optimization ideas.Aiming at the green performance of buildings proposed in Green Building Evaluation Standard(GB/T 50378—2019),the simulation of green performance is carried out through the method of the integration of BIM technology and green building design.The paper sorts out the green residential area planning and design strategies based on the suitability of ecological design,and carries out the design practice of green residential are planning by taking a residential area in Xixian New District of Xi’an as an example,and determines the suitable green residential area design strategies,which supplements and improves the green residential design theories in Xi’an area or even the country,and provides a theoretical preference for the similar projects in the future.

关 键 词:居住区规划 绿色设计 性能模拟 生态设计
